    I would argue that your characterization of what we’re trying to do....”chuck 50+ 3s “ is not accurate and pretty misleading.

    Our game plan is to get as many open 3 point attempts as we can. Well other than Harden, because he’s proven to make contested 3s. And we are really, really, really, really good at getting open 3 point attempts.

    Whether that yields 30 or 50 overall shots really just depends on how a game goes. But I believe as long as we are generating mostly open looks there’s no reason to go away from it.

    I don’t believe going for 2 point shots outside of the paint unless it’s late clock forced situations. We no longer have anyone good enough at it.
